Because the device is common, tech forums are filled with files.

WARNING: Downloading firmware from a forum is like eating food from a dumpster. It could work, or it could "brick" your device (turn it into a useless paperweight). Always scan .bin files with VirusTotal before proceeding.

Access the web interface of the GM220-S (usually by typing 192.168.1.1 or a similar gateway IP into a browser). Login and look for a "System Status" or "Device Info" tab. Note the current firmware version.

When updating firmware, it's crucial to follow the manufacturer's instructions precisely. Firmware updates can sometimes brick a device if not performed correctly. Ensure you:

If you have more specific details about the GM220-S device, I could offer more targeted advice.

Even if you follow the steps, things go wrong. Here is how to fix common GM220-S firmware failures.

Summary: This document provides a comprehensive narrative covering the GM220‑S firmware lifecycle: typical device behavior, common failure modes, firmware update workflows, rollback and recovery procedures, testing strategies, and a sample maintenance playbook for operators. It assumes an embedded device (GM220‑S) that runs a monolithic firmware image managing radio/networking, device I/O, and a small OS/kernel. Adjust details to your specific hardware and vendor-provided tools.